On Tuesday (May 27), Blake Shelton took to X to personally respond to those who have been critical of him and Gwen Stefani pre-recording their performances at the 2025 American Music Awards on Monday night. “Just now seeing these stories about Gwen and I pretaping our performances for the AMA’s,” Shelton wrote. “We came and performed when the show asked us to.. Really nothing else to say. 🤷‍♂️” During the award show broadcast, Shelton debuted his song, “Stay Country or Die Tryin,'” and later introduced his wife’s performance, where Stefani delivered a medley which featured her country-tinged new single, “Swallow My Tears,” as well as her 2006 hit “The Sweet Escape” and her 2005 Billboard Hot 100 No. 1 smash, “Hollaback Girl.” Attendees at the event posted their frustrations on TikTok about the pre-recorded performances, claiming that they expected to see all artists promoted by the show performing live during the ceremony.
